Description

The MS21103D12 is a genuine Textron Aviation clamp — a fastening or retaining hardware item used in the airframe. It fits the Bonanza F33, G33, F33A or F33C. It carries an export classification of ECCN 9A991. Built by Beechcraft — the Wichita, Kansas manufacturer founded in 1932 and part of Textron Aviation since 2014 — this part carries a name long associated with rugged, capable aircraft. The Beechcraft Bonanza is widely regarded as holding the longest production run of any aircraft — from its 1947 debut until Textron announced in November 2025 that it would wind down Bonanza and Baron production as the order backlog clears.
